服务器换系统重装是解决系统崩溃、性能瓶颈或安全漏洞的最彻底手段,其核心价值在于能够清除所有累积的系统垃圾与潜在威胁,让服务器恢复至最佳的初始运行状态,这一过程并非简单的“下一步”操作,而是一项需要严谨规划、专业执行与完整验证的系统工程,任何细微的疏忽都可能导致不可逆的数据丢失或业务长时间中断。

前期准备:数据安全是不可逾越的红线
在执行任何操作之前,必须建立“数据至上”的底线思维,服务器换系统重装意味着原系统盘数据将被清空,完整且可验证的备份是整个流程的第一步,也是决定成败的关键一步。
-
全量数据备份
务必对系统盘以外的数据盘进行快照备份,或将关键业务数据下载至本地,对于数据库服务,必须先停止写入服务,确保数据一致性问题,再进行物理文件拷贝或逻辑导出。 -
配置信息归档
记录当前服务器的关键配置信息,包括但不限于IP地址、子网掩码、网关、DNS配置,以及已开放的端口列表,这些信息在系统重装后需要重新配置,遗漏任何一项都可能导致业务无法访问。 -
确认兼容性
根据业务需求选择合适的新操作系统版本,老旧的业务系统可能无法在最新的操作系统上运行,而过于陈旧的操作系统则可能面临安全补丁停止支持的风险,需在官方文档中确认硬件驱动与新系统的兼容性。
实施阶段:精准操作与核心配置
进入实质性的重装阶段,操作的核心在于选择正确的镜像与网络配置,确保服务器“装好即通”。
-
选择官方纯净镜像
强烈建议使用云服务商提供的官方公共镜像或微软官方原版ISO文件,第三方精简版镜像虽然体积小,但往往缺失关键系统组件或植入后门,严重违背E-E-A-T原则中的安全性与可信度要求。 -
分区规划策略
在进行服务器换系统重装时,合理的分区规划能有效防止系统日志撑爆磁盘,建议将系统盘(C盘/根分区)与数据盘分开,对于Linux系统,建议单独划分/var 和 /home 分区;对于Windows系统,建议系统盘预留足够空间(建议100GB以上),避免因系统更新导致磁盘占满。
-
网络与安全初始化
系统安装完毕首次启动后,应立即配置网络IP与安全组(防火墙)策略。- 修改默认端口:修改SSH(Linux)或RDP(Windows)的默认端口,降低暴力破解风险。
- 禁用Root/Admin远程登录:创建普通权限用户进行日常运维,仅在必要时提权。
- 安装安全组件:第一时间安装主机安全软件与杀毒软件,构筑基础防御防线。
环境部署与调优:从“能用”到“好用”
系统重装只是基础,环境搭建与性能调优才是决定服务器生产效率的核心环节,这一阶段需要根据业务特性进行定制化配置。
-
运行环境搭建
根据业务架构安装Web服务、数据库及运行环境,推荐使用LNMP、LAMP等一键包或Docker容器化部署,这比手工编译安装更稳定、更易于维护,务必注意软件版本的一致性,避免因版本差异引发的代码报错。 -
系统内核参数优化
默认的系统内核参数往往无法满足高并发业务需求,需优化文件描述符数量、TCP连接复用及超时时间。- 增大文件句柄数:防止高并发下“Too many open files”错误。
- 优化Swap分区:合理设置Swap使用倾向,避免物理内存耗尽导致进程被杀。
-
服务自启动配置
确保关键业务服务(如Nginx、MySQL、Java应用)已设置为开机自启动,可通过systemctl enable命令或chkconfig工具进行设置,避免服务器意外重启后业务长时间停滞。
验收与监控:构建闭环运维体系
服务器换系统重装的最后一步并非交付使用,而是全面的验收测试,没有经过验证的系统不能投入生产环境。
-
功能完整性测试
模拟真实用户访问,测试网页加载速度、数据库读写响应、API接口连通性,检查日志文件是否正常生成,确保没有报错信息。
-
性能压力测试
使用Apache Bench或JMeter工具进行压力测试,对比重装前后的性能数据,如果发现性能下降,需排查是否驱动未安装正确或资源分配不合理。 -
建立监控快照
部署监控Agent,配置CPU、内存、磁盘I/O的报警阈值,保留一份重装后的纯净系统快照,一旦未来系统再次出现难以修复的故障,可利用快照实现分钟级回滚,极大缩短故障恢复时间(MTTR)。
相关问答模块
问:服务器换系统重装后,原数据盘的数据会丢失吗?
答:通常情况下,系统重装仅针对系统盘进行格式化和写入操作,数据盘的内容默认会保留,但在操作前,务必在控制台确认“格式化数据盘”选项未被勾选,如果数据盘依赖于旧系统的LVM配置或特定挂载服务,重装后可能需要手动挂载,建议操作前咨询服务商技术支持。
问:如何在重装系统后快速恢复业务环境?
答:建议在重装前编写自动化部署脚本或制作自定义镜像,对于标准化的业务环境,可以将Web服务、数据库配置及业务代码打包成Docker镜像,重装系统后,只需安装Docker引擎并拉取镜像,即可在几分钟内恢复业务,这种方式比逐一手动安装软件效率提升数倍。
如果您在服务器运维过程中遇到过类似问题,或有更好的系统迁移方案,欢迎在评论区分享您的经验。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/79366.html